Top 5 end of the world movies

When faced with a catastrophe, everyone behaves differently. While some are returning to the familiar fare of Friends and The Office, others are going straight for the meat: apocalyptic movies and television. There’s something curiously comfortable about witnessing a global calamity develop onscreen, whether it’s in blockbuster disaster movies or more thoughtful End Times fare. Get your dose below with the best end-of-the-world movies available to stream right now.

1.   Mad Max: Fury Road (2015): Mad Max: Fury Road was an instant hit upon its debut, thanks to Charlize Theron’s powerful portrayal as Imperator Furiosa and the film’s operatic vision of a post-apocalyptic wasteland.

2.   Children of Men (2006): The idea is straightforward: people have become sterile for unknown reasons. However, the scenario depicted in Children of Men—based on the novel of the same name—is frightening, in which adults continue to live in an increasingly torn society, knowing that there is little chance for the race’s future.

3.   Independence Day (1996): Aliens! 4th of July! Will Smith, please! What could a single blockbuster possibly offer? Independence Day more than makes up for its lack of highbrow credentials with physical force and popcorn-ready fun.

4.   Contagion (2011): Since the coronavirus pandemic began, fans and journalists alike have revisited Contagion in the hopes of learning more about our current predicament.

5.   Melancholia (2011): Contagion may have depicted the devastation that a pandemic might cause, but Melancholia best captures our current state of mind for many of us—those fortunate enough to work from home or reside in areas with low case counts.
